WitrynaWhen two immiscible fluids exist within a rock surface, the surface tends to be in contact preferentially with one of them. This wetting phase will displace the nonwetting fluid from the surface and tends to spread over the rock surface. Witryna2 dni temu · A multi-relaxation time lattice-Boltzmann model is employed to investigate the dynamic evolution of two immiscible phases through an artificial, randomly generated, porous structure. The flow is driven by a constant pressure gradient, in the absence of gravitational effects. Witryna11 wrz 2024 · One phase usually is an aqueous solvent and the other phase is an organic solvent, such as the pentane used to extract trihalomethanes from water. Because the phases are immiscible they form two layers, with the denser phase on the bottom. The solute initially is present in one of the two phases; after the extraction it …

WitrynaAn immiscible polymer blend can have several morphologies—from dispersed phase to continuous. The percolation threshold is then the phase inversion of one polymer when it changes from the dispersed phase to continuous [21,22]. WitrynaAn emulsion is a mixture of generally immiscibleliquids(phases), such as oil and water. In emulsions, two immiscibleliquids are blended by dispersing one liquid(the dispersed phase) in the other(the continuous phase). WitrynaThe two immiscible phases flow counter-currently, resulting in the solvent extract phase containing the solute and the raffinate, which is the feed phase after removal of the solute.
